In this PR we reconciliate the failure indices of a data stream just like we do for the backing indices. The only difference is that a data stream can have an empty list of failure indices, while it cannot have an empty list of backing indices.

An easy way to create a situation where certain backing or failure indices are not included in a snapshot is via using exclusions in the multi-target expression of the snapshot. For example:

PUT /_snapshot/my_repository/my-snapshot?wait_for_completion=true
{
  "indices": "my-ds*", "-.fs-my-ds-000001"
}
